We have just returned from five wonderful nights at Noble Woods. We had a very welcome from Lynne, who gave us a choice of pitches and said we could position the caravan anyway we liked.
We ended up on Pitch EB, which must have been the size of half a tennis court with its own driveway.
The pitch had its own water supply, as well as a large table and chairs and its own fire pit (as do all the pitches). We met Stan, the other owner, who gave us lots of information about the local area and we also bought a box of logs from him for £5 which was plenty for five nights so we could sit out and enjoy a glass of wine.
There is a huge enclosed dog field, where our dog had a brilliant time running around with other dogs.
The toilets and showers were spotless with plenty of hot water and powerful showers. Stan seemed to be checking the facilities several times a day.
There are only a few pitches suitable for caravans and motorhomes, and the approach road should be driven with care.
There are several good walks from the site, including one into Grange over Sands where you will find all the shops and cafes that you need. Cartmel is also very well worth a visit - we were lucky enough to watch a wedding taking place at the local church.
All in all a brilliant site, and we will definitely be booking to visit again.

Absolutely amazing setting! So peaceful and quiet.
Owners greeted us on arrival after calling them 10 mins before arriving (as requested) and they showed us to our pitch and left us too it, they offered to lend us a electric hook up extension if we needed it.
Lovely clean toilets and showers and saw them being cleaned regularly by one of the owners. Washing up area had hot water.
Could park next to the pitch and our pitch overlooked the pond/lake that is in the middle. Felt very private and could enjoy the peace and quiet.
Had a little walk around the wooded areas and collected some sticks for our fire pit. You are allowed to have a fire that is off the ground.
A stone slab was provided at the pitch and we used our own fire pit. Our pitch had astro turf on the ground which was good as it did rain and we weren't left with a swampy area or muddy tent.
Definitely something different to the usual camping in a big field with lots of kids and loud music!
Overall fantastic and will be back next year!

Amazing and unique site, set in private woodlands with pitches well spaced out, portaloos plus toilet and shower block, washing up station, disposal point, drinking water taps.
Each pitch has own dustbin emptied daily. Portaloos, showers plus toilets all cleaned regularly, hand sanitiser available at each portaloo and toilet blocks.
The owners, Lynne and Stan are so helpful and are constantly working around the site, which is such a real credit to their hard work. A lovely, genuine couple that are friendly and willing to stop for a chat and help with anything at all.
We would recommend for anyone looking to get back to nature, for a peaceful get away. Thanks a million, Lynne and Stan xx
